Problem details: Very agonizing and annoying input latency spikes every minute or so. Input latency is constantly at around 1 but then randomly jumps to like 7-15 and my game skips a couple frames and i get like 3 yellow dots instantly next to the MS counter, sometimes more sometimes less. FPS is always around 600-700 in game, 240 in menu. I've tried every SINGLE fucking video trying to help with this problem and searched through the entire forum for a fix but nothing has helped. Also the spikes don't happen only in game, they happen in the menus aswell.

Edit: I put the AP mod on and played a random map and kept my eyes on the 2 counters. As i said my frames are always around 600 but what i noticed is that in the span of like 4 seconds my frames would lower to around 400 and then the input latency spike happens and my frames skip. spencer1404
Try using compatibility mode (you can enable it ingame in the renderer options section)
If compatibility mode doesn't work:
- Update your Graphics card drivers
- Make sure your osu! is fullscreen and not borderless or windowed
- If you have any background apps (like discord) close them or disable hardware acceleration (if the program supports it)
- Make sure your power saving settings at least on balanced or high performance
- Make sure you HAVEN'T set you osu! to Realtime in task manager
If Nothing here works then as a last resort, uninstall the game and possibly even factory reset your pc (if you want to keep your osu! data then make sure you back up the songs, skins, screenshots, replays, and export folders).

Also you are using a Integrated GPU and a 240hz monitor, you could be straining you CPU so much that it can't handle 240hz.
Try 144hz or 60hz temporarily and see if that does anything (Kinda sucks ik)
